Experiencing local cultures while traveling doesn't have to break the bank. One of the most affordable tips is to participate in free walking tours, which are offered in many cities around the world. These tours allow you to explore the local sights while gaining insight into the culture from knowledgeable guides. Additionally, be sure to visit local markets and street fairs where you can immerse yourself in authentic food, art, and traditional crafts at a low cost. Another great way to connect with the local community is to use public transportation, which not only saves money but also offers a unique glimpse into daily life.
To deepen your cultural experience on a budget, consider **attending local festivals or events**, which often showcase traditional music, dance, and food, providing a rich tapestry of local culture. Moreover, staying at hostels or guesthouses rather than hotels can foster interactions with locals and other travelers, offering insights and recommendations that guidebooks might miss. Finally, you can choose to travel during the off-peak seasons, where you can find affordable accommodation and engage in local cultures without the crowds, allowing for a more intimate travel experience.
When traveling to a new destination, finding hidden gems that won’t break the bank can enhance your experience immensely. Start by using local guidebooks or apps that focus on off-the-beaten-path attractions rather than mainstream tourist spots. In addition, consider joining local community forums or social media groups where residents share their favorite budget-friendly sites and activities. This insider information can lead you to quaint cafes, unique shops, and stunning viewpoints that are often overlooked by conventional travel guides.
Another approach to discovering hidden gems is to venture away from typical tourist areas. Wander through residential neighborhoods or lesser-known parks to absorb the authentic vibe of the place. You might also find affordable restaurants and street food vendors that the locals flock to, giving you a taste of authentic cuisine without the inflated prices. Remember to keep your eyes open for free events or festivals that may not be widely advertised—they often provide an opportunity to experience local culture without overspending.
When exploring new destinations, many travelers aspire to eat like a local, enjoying authentic cuisine that reflects the culture and traditions of the area. However, indulging in these culinary experiences can often stretch a budget. The key to achieving this balance lies in researching local dining habits and hotspots. Start by visiting street food markets or local food stalls, which usually offer delicious meals at a fraction of the price of fancy restaurants. Additionally, consider dining during lunch hours when many establishments provide budget-friendly lunch specials or عروض. This not only allows you to sample local flavors but also helps you immerse yourself in the vibrant atmosphere of the local community.
Another effective strategy to eat like a local on a budget is to engage with residents and seek their recommendations. You can ask locals for their favorite spots or join community events, where food is often a focal point. Participating in a cooking class can also provide valuable insights into local ingredients and preparation methods, making it easier to recreate your favorites at home without overspending. Don’t forget to explore grocery stores and markets for fresh produce and local delicacies that you can enjoy for a fraction of the cost. By combining these tips, you can savor the essence of your destination without compromising your budget.
